Ben is 20 years older than Daniel. Ben and Daniel first met two years ago. Three years ago, Ben was 33 times as old as Daniel.

Answer: 33

<u>Step-by-step explanation:</u>

           <u>Today </u>                <u>3 years ago</u>

Ben:   x + 20                  (x + 20) - 3    

Dan:     x                          x - 3


  3 years ago, Ben was 3 times as old as Daniel

⇒  (x + 20) - 3  = 3(x - 3)

       x + 17        = 3x - 9

             17        = 2x - 9

             26       = 2x

             13        = x


Today, Ben = x + 20

                   = 13 + 20

                   = 33
